Output 91fb4f029b2c3ef4d6e4e9200ad988da19d907dacf3d008fa7b73590edbcb85f:0

value
23490583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dd0e8bbf13da8fc2c5cc37d2544f6f742baab11 OP_EQUAL
address
35sGbSFH3xepwxZSxpVvdewVeJxMFGgJf7
transaction
91fb4f029b2c3ef4d6e4e9200ad988da19d907dacf3d008fa7b73590edbcb85f
confirmations
345718
spent
true